Top 12 September Getaways for Relaxation

Kovalam:  This serene coastal town along the Arabian Sea is often called the 'Paradise of the South' and is known for its palm-fringed beaches and tranquil ambiance.

Mahabaleshwar:  Located near Mumbai, Mahabaleshwar is a hill station known for its mesmerizing waterfalls, historic forts, temples, and lush strawberry plantations.

Srinagar:  Often referred to as "heaven on earth," Srinagar offers breathtaking views of Dal Lake, majestic mountains, Mughal gardens, and sprawling orchards.

Leh:  Nestled at 11,500 feet above sea level, Leh is a dream destination for adventure seekers, with iconic monasteries and captivating landscapes.

Pondicherry:  This coastal town, once a French colony, charms visitors with its unique blend of Indian and French culture.

Gulmarg:  Known as the "Meadow of Flowers," Gulmarg in Jammu & Kashmir offers stunning views and boasts the world's highest golf course.

Goa:  Renowned as India's party destination, Goa attracts travelers with its beautiful beaches, historic churches, forts, and vibrant nightlife.

Amritsar:  Home to the iconic Golden Temple, Amritsar captivates with colorful markets, delicious street food, and rich historical landmarks.

Rishikesh:  Known as the "Yoga Capital of the World," Rishikesh is a tranquil Himalayan town famous for its ancient temples, bohemian cafes, and adventure sports.

Havelock Island:  Part of the Andamans, Havelock Island boasts pristine white sand beaches and captivating coral reefs, making it a paradise for nature enthusiasts.

Varanasi:  One of the world's oldest cities, Varanasi is a spiritual and cultural hub on the banks of the Ganges River.
